A function key (control) character > >sequence can be of arbitrary length. The up-arrow key on my keyboard > >sends three characters, whereas a typical F-key sends 5 characters. > > The character sequence should follow ANSI X3.64, meaning that it begins > with an ESC character and continues through an alpha. That can be > parsed without any timeouts at all. I have already written code to parse ANSI X3.64 sequences, but since there's so many non-ANSI terminals out there, I'm not really sure I want to lock myself into ANSI-compatible terminals (even though I'd like to). > What probably is contributing to the confusion is that you bought > keyboards that have an ESC key the user can press that violates the > X3.64 standard. Remove the key or tell your users how to recover > from it (treating a second consecutive ESC specially is one way). I'd like to get rid of all escape keys in the world (that's why I only buy VT220-style keyboards nowadays), but on the other hand, I don't think an escape key violates the standard. As I recall, all function key sequences should start with the CSI 8-bit character or 7-bit character sequence (ESC [) and end with an alphanumeric character.
